首页  > 教育解读  > 八位二进制是怎么算的

八位二进制是怎么算的

2025-05-04 06:23:51
未来是拼出来的
未来是拼出来的已认证

未来是拼出来的为您分享以下优质知识

八位编码二进制的计算主要涉及二进制数的表示范围、转换方法及应用场景,具体如下:

一、基本定义与表示范围

结构定义

八位二进制数由8个0或1组成,例如`11111111`或`00000000`,每个位对应2的幂次方(从右至左依次为2⁰、2¹、2²等)。

数值范围

- 最小值:

全0时为0(2⁰=1);

- 最大值:全1时为2⁷-1=127,但实际应用中8位二进制常表示0-255的范围(含符号扩展)。

二、十进制与二进制转换方法

十进制转二进制

- 除2取余法:

将十进制数不断除以2,记录余数,最后将余数倒序排列。例如,十进制255转换为二进制为`11111111`;

- 补足8位:若结果不足8位,在前面补0。例如,十进制1转换为二进制为`00000001`。

二进制转十进制

将二进制数按位权展开求和,例如`11111111`=1×2⁷+1×2⁶+...+1×2⁰=255。

三、应用场景

计算机存储:

8位(1字节)是计算机基本数据单位,可表示0-255的整数,适用于字符编码(如ASCII)和简单数据存储;

补码表示:用于表示负数,例如`10000000`表示-128(2⁷+2⁰)。

四、示例

最大值计算:`11111111`(二进制)=1×2⁷+1×2⁶+...+1×2⁰=255(十进制);

最小值计算:`00000000`(二进制)=0(十进制)。

以上内容综合了二进制基础、转换规则及实际应用,确保信息全面且准确。